avformat/matroskaenc: Improve Cues in case of no video
The Matroska muxer currently only adds CuePoints in three cases: a) For video keyframes. b) For the first audio frame in a new Cluster if in DASH-mode. c) For subtitles. This means that ordinary Matroska audio files won't have any Cues which impedes seeking. This commit changes this. For every track in a file without video track it is checked and tracked whether a Cue entry has already been added for said track for the current Cluster. This is used to add a Cue entry for each first packet of each track in each Cluster. Implements #3149. Signed-off-by: Andreas Rheinhardt <andreas.rheinhardt@gmail.com>

diff --git a/libavformat/matroskaenc.c b/libavformat/matroskaenc.c
index 116b89fb4d..a65221e143 100644
--- a/libavformat/matroskaenc.c
+++ b/libavformat/matroskaenc.c
@@ -2123,6 +2123,10 @@ static void mkv_end_cluster(AVFormatContext *s)
MatroskaMuxContext *mkv = s->priv_data;
end_ebml_master_crc32(s->pb, &mkv->cluster_bc, mkv, MATROSKA_ID_CLUSTER, 0, 1);
+ if (!mkv->have_video) {
+ for (unsigned i = 0; i < s->nb_streams; i++)
+ mkv->tracks[i].has_cue = 0;
+ }
mkv->cluster_pos = -1;
avio_write_marker(s->pb, AV_NOPTS_VALUE, AVIO_DATA_MARKER_FLUSH_POINT);
}
@@ -2225,7 +2229,7 @@ static int mkv_check_new_extra_data(AVFormatContext *s, AVPacket *pkt)
return 0;
}
-static int mkv_write_packet_internal(AVFormatContext *s, AVPacket *pkt, int add_cue)
+static int mkv_write_packet_internal(AVFormatContext *s, AVPacket *pkt)
{
MatroskaMuxContext *mkv = s->priv_data;
AVIOContext *pb;
@@ -2271,10 +2275,12 @@ static int mkv_write_packet_internal(AVFormatContext *s, AVPacket *pkt, int add_
ret = mkv_write_block(s, pb, MATROSKA_ID_SIMPLEBLOCK, pkt, keyframe);
if (ret < 0)
return ret;
- if ((s->pb->seekable & AVIO_SEEKABLE_NORMAL) && (par->codec_type == AVMEDIA_TYPE_VIDEO && keyframe || add_cue)) {
+ if ((s->pb->seekable & AVIO_SEEKABLE_NORMAL) && keyframe &&
+ (par->codec_type == AVMEDIA_TYPE_VIDEO || !mkv->have_video && !track->has_cue)) {
ret = mkv_add_cuepoint(mkv, pkt->stream_index, ts,
mkv->cluster_pos, relative_packet_pos, -1);
if (ret < 0) return ret;
+ track->has_cue = 1;
}
} else {
if (par->codec_id == AV_CODEC_ID_WEBVTT) {
@@ -2340,8 +2346,7 @@ static int mkv_write_packet(AVFormatContext *s, AVPacket *pkt)
// on seeing key frames.
start_new_cluster = keyframe;
} else if (mkv->is_dash && codec_type == AVMEDIA_TYPE_AUDIO &&
- (mkv->cluster_pos == -1 ||
- cluster_time > mkv->cluster_time_limit)) {
+ cluster_time > mkv->cluster_time_limit) {
// For DASH audio, we create a Cluster based on cluster_time_limit
start_new_cluster = 1;
} else if (!mkv->is_dash &&
@@ -2365,9 +2370,7 @@ static int mkv_write_packet(AVFormatContext *s, AVPacket *pkt)
// check if we have an audio packet cached
if (mkv->cur_audio_pkt.size > 0) {
- // for DASH audio, a CuePoint has to be added when there is a new cluster.
- ret = mkv_write_packet_internal(s, &mkv->cur_audio_pkt,
- mkv->is_dash ? start_new_cluster : 0);
+ ret = mkv_write_packet_internal(s, &mkv->cur_audio_pkt);
av_packet_unref(&mkv->cur_audio_pkt);
if (ret < 0) {
av_log(s, AV_LOG_ERROR,
@@ -2382,7 +2385,7 @@ static int mkv_write_packet(AVFormatContext *s, AVPacket *pkt)
if (pkt->size > 0)
ret = av_packet_ref(&mkv->cur_audio_pkt, pkt);
} else
- ret = mkv_write_packet_internal(s, pkt, 0);
+ ret = mkv_write_packet_internal(s, pkt);
return ret;
}
@@ -2410,7 +2413,7 @@ static int mkv_write_trailer(AVFormatContext *s)
// check if we have an audio packet cached
if (mkv->cur_audio_pkt.size > 0) {
- ret = mkv_write_packet_internal(s, &mkv->cur_audio_pkt, 0);
+ ret = mkv_write_packet_internal(s, &mkv->cur_audio_pkt);
if (ret < 0) {
av_log(s, AV_LOG_ERROR,
"Could not write cached audio packet ret:%d\n", ret);
